Output 58815ecf774caa246a45c03c17bba392a2e4613e7d7f455084b003f83ff2f5ec:7

value
4111000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e6a8018f0e10ec6f7bd69887cc86561e18f26e1 OP_EQUAL
address
38qeDHMEtWHBsPLxteLoepKfxkFstw62JG
transaction
58815ecf774caa246a45c03c17bba392a2e4613e7d7f455084b003f83ff2f5ec
spent
true